管理层讨论与分析
相对上期新增的文字 · 来源:10-Q · 2026-05-07
On March 23, 2026, we introduced a mobile application to be used with the MyoPro, replacing the use of an external laptop.
On November 4, 2025 (“the Closing Date”), we entered into a Loan and Security Agreement with with Avenue Capital Management II, L.P., as administrative agent and collateral agent and Avenue Venture Opportunities Fund II, L.P., as a lender (together "Avenue"), which provides us $17.5 million in commi…
In November 2025, we were notified that Ryzur Medical filed for bankruptcy in China and is in the process of being liquidated. As a result, the operations of the JV Company are now severely limited. Chinaleaf Capital, a minority investor in the JV Company, is currently leading the process of restruc…
All assets associated with our investment in the JV Company were either reserved or written off in prior periods. As a result, these events had no impact on our financial statements for the three months ended March 31, 2026 and the year ended December 31, 2025.

如何读 10-Q 的风险因素(第 1A 项)
10-Q 的风险因素章节有三种常见形态,本页按其一分类展示:
- 指向(pointer) — 公司仅声明"无重大变化"并指向年度 10-K 的完整风险因素;本季没有自己的风险文本可对比。
- 部分更新(partial) — 公司写明"除下述外无重大变化",只更新部分风险;摘录展示的正是本季新增的内容。
- 全文重述(restated) — 本季重新给出完整风险因素。若上一季只是"指向",则无法逐段对比,本页会将其标为"本季全文重述"。
这只是对文件结构的客观描述,不构成对风险高低的判断。
